STAAR 2023-24 . % Meets Grade Level or AboveWhat this means: On the STAAR, Texas's statewide test, about 15 of every 100 students at this school read at grade level and about 9 of 100 do math at grade level. Across all Texas schools, those numbers are about 52 and 42. Reading scores are down about 14 points since 2020, while math scores are down about 14 points.

Demographically-adjusted score · methodologyWhat this means: About 10% of students here test proficient in math and reading, below the roughly 33% typical for Texas schools with a similar share of low-income students. BeatsExpectations compares each school with others at the same poverty level, not by raw scores, so a school lands here when its results trail those comparable schools, which is not the same as having low scores. A higher-scoring school can still fall in this tier if similar schools score higher still.

EDWARD BRISCOE EL is an elementary-level community of compact scale in FORT WORTH, Texas, one of the schools within FORT WORTH ISD, educateing 288 students in grades pre-K through 5. Compared to the state average of about 519 students per school, that is 45% below typical.
EDWARD BRISCOE EL is one of 136 schools operated by FORT WORTH ISD, a district that hosts 70,612 students overall.
On the student-mix side, EDWARD BRISCOE EL lists that Black students make up the majority at 69%. Other groups include 23% Hispanic, 4% White, 2% multiracial. By comparison, Tarrant County as a whole is about 18% Black, so the school skews visibly more Black than its surroundings.
On the resource side, On paper, EDWARD BRISCOE EL has 21 full-time-equivalent teachers, translating to a class-load average of around 13.7:1. The state averages around 15.1:1, so this campus is tighter than the state norm typical. Roughly 93% of students at EDWARD BRISCOE EL qualify for free or reduced-price lunch, which schools and policymakers use as a rough income-mix signal. That share is higher than Tarrant County's rate of about 63%.
On a demographically-adjusted basis, On a poverty-adjusted basis, EDWARD BRISCOE EL sits in the bottom 10% statewide. Predicted proficiency from the FRL regression is roughly 33.3%; actual is 10.4%, a gap of -22.9 points.
Across the wider county, Tarrant County reports that median household income runs about $84,207, about 35% of the adult population holds a bachelor's degree or above, and census figures put the poverty rate at about 8%. In all, Tarrant County runs 639 public schools (combined enrollment of about 385,835 students), of which EDWARD BRISCOE EL is one.
The closest other public school is MORNINGSIDE MIDDLE, roughly 0.3 miles away. 8 of the 8 nearest public schools sit inside a five-mile radius. Among the 9 schools in that immediate cluster with test data (this one included), EDWARD BRISCOE EL ranks 9th on composite proficiency, behind the local average of 29.1%.
Geographically, the school is in a metropolitan area.
Over the past 7-year window. EDWARD BRISCOE EL's enrollment has shrank 38% since 2018, when it stood at 464 (now 288). Over the same period, the Hispanic share ticked up from 18% to 23%.
